 EG> The opponents' percentage is a compilation of w-l records. So if, for
 EG> example, Seattle is 8-5 and Oakland is 4-9 (not counting a game
 EG> against KC), KC's opponents' percentage for just those teams would be
 EG> .462. If Seattle beats Oakland then their record goes to 9-5 and
 EG> Oakland's goes to 4-10 and KC's percentage would be .464. It doesn't
 EG> make a difference WHO wins but merely playing each other LOWERS KC's
 EG> percentage. When an out of division team wins, it's MORE beneficial to
 EG> the Chiefs than a game inside the division.
That's what I meant.  The Raiders fading down the stretch neither hurt nor 
helped KC's opponents' winning percentage.
